An MRI technologist is a highly skilled professional responsible for operating MRI machines, which are essential tools in medical imaging. These machines utilize a combination of radio waves and magnetic fields to produce detailed images of the body’s internal structures. MRI imaging enables physicians to detect pathology with greater accuracy, leading to faster and more precise diagnoses. By performing these scans, MRI technologists play a crucial role in helping healthcare providers identify and address medical conditions effectively, ultimately improving patient outcomes.

Exploring the Salary Spectrum for MRI Technologists

Like most professions, MRI technologist salaries fall within a broad range, reflecting variations in experience, location, and employer type. In 2024, MRI technologists reported earning an average salary of $92,729, with geographic differences playing a significant role. For example, technologists in California earned the highest average salary at $125,843, while those in Nebraska earned a lower average of $61,924. While these figures provide a general idea, pinpointing your exact salary can be challenging, as it depends on factors such as your level of experience, additional certifications, and the demand for MRI professionals in your region.  As always, we recommend referring to the Bureau of Labor Statistics.

Comprehensive Guide to MRI Technologist Salaries: The Big Picture

When it comes to MRI technologist salaries, several factors play a significant role in determining earning potential. From experience level and certifications to geographic location and employer type, each element can impact how much you earn in the field. Understanding these key influences can help you plan your career path and take strategic steps to maximize your salary as an MRI technologist.

  1. Experience Level: Technologists with more years of experience or specialized expertise often command higher salaries.
  2. Geographic Location: Salaries can vary significantly by state or region, with areas like California offering higher average pay compared to others like Nebraska.
  3. Type of Employer: MRI technologists working in hospitals, outpatient imaging centers, or specialty clinics may see differences in pay based on the organization’s resources and demand.  In 2023 and 2024, those MRI technologists that opted for travel assignments can earn a annual wage at a much higher level.
  4. Certifications and Specializations: Additional credentials, such as advanced certifications as MRI Safety Officer or “MRSO” can make you a key component to any clinical operation which in the long run can allow you to command a higher salary.

Your MRI tech salary is not a constant number. There are a lot of factors that can change it over time, and education is perhaps the most important key to advancements in the field.
